Transaction 9531a117a61ac28a9f66d091ed91f56772361c2c28bc6925a98c3c0b79649e17
1 Input
1 Output
-
9531a117a61ac28a9f66d091ed91f56772361c2c28bc6925a98c3c0b79649e17:0
- value
- 500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70cdae463d175012b60e09e3cdb7cac570bdebce OP_EQUAL
- address
- 3ByTzyhmDQPQ6DP3v7v2y3TworYDHMJySi